i might still have a couple sets laying around. all you have to do is change the bulbs to 12v and they work well. watch out, though, the later model ones were plastic. i like the metal ones better, the screws dont strip out when they get beat up

Keep watching Ebay (I use 'military lights'...find more cool stuff that way...just picked up one of the pushbutton dashboard light switches that I'm going to retro-fit once I get my hands on a wiring diagram) and you'll find a good deal. The buckets don't pop up very often, so you may want to go with one of the surplus outfits for those. Got mine years ago from a place called Surplus Enterprizes...not sure if they're still around. You can also pick up side marker buckets off the civvy rigs from the Hummer dealer and recess those as well.
